S.M.A.R.T. Goals in Game Design: How to Set Objectives That Actually Work
What Are S.M.A.R.T. Goals?
S.M.A.R.T. is a goal-setting framework designed to improve clarity and efficiency when defining objectives. It stands for:
- Specific – Clearly define what you want to achieve.
- Measurable – Establish criteria to track progress.
- Achievable – Ensure the goal is realistic given the available resources.
- Relevant – Align with broader objectives and priorities.
- Time-bound – Set a deadline to maintain focus and urgency.
Why S.M.A.R.T. Goals Matter in Game Design
Game development is filled with ambitious ideas, but poor goal-setting often leads to scope creep, delays, or unfinished projects. By applying the S.M.A.R.T. framework, teams can:
- Keep tasks aligned with the overall vision.
- Track progress and adjust where necessary.
- Prioritize effectively to avoid wasted resources.
- Improve team motivation with clear milestones.
Applying S.M.A.R.T. to Game Development
- Feature Implementation
- Non-SMART: "Improve AI behaviors."
- S.M.A.R.T.: "Enhance enemy AI pathfinding by implementing obstacle avoidance using A* algorithm within the next four sprints."
- Player Retention Goals
- Non-SMART: "Increase player retention."
- S.M.A.R.T.: "Boost D7 retention from 25% to 30% over the next quarter by refining onboarding and progression systems."
- Bug Fixing
- Non-SMART: "Fix performance issues."
- S.M.A.R.T.: "Reduce average frame time from 22ms to 16ms on mid-range hardware before the next major update."
Conclusion
S.M.A.R.T. goals provide a structured approach to development, ensuring objectives remain practical and achievable. By integrating this framework, game designers and developers can enhance productivity, avoid common pitfalls, and maintain project momentum.